Cóctel de Camaron
Cóctel de Camarón is a Mexican shrimp cocktail that combines juicy shrimp, a tangy tomato sauce, and a mix of fresh ingredients!
Ingredients
- 5 cups water
- 1 pound large shrimp, (peeled, deveined, shell off)
- 2 teaspoons kosher salt, (plus more to taste)
- 1 ¼ cup Clamato juice (or tomato juice)
- 1 cup ketchup
- ¼ cup orange soda (or orange juice)
- 4 tablespoons lime juice ((about 2 limes))
- 2 Roma tomatoes, (finely diced)
- 1 English cucumber, (finely diced)
- 1 jalapeño, (finely diced)
- ½ white onion, (finely diced)
- 1 cup finely chopped cilantro
- 1 avocado, (diced)
- Saltines or tostadas, (for serving)
Instructions
-
Add the water and salt to a medium pot and bring to a boil. While the water is heating up, prepare a large bowl of ice water and set aside.
-
When boiling, add the shrimp and poach for 2-3 minutes until the shrimp are bright pink.
-
Strain the shrimp and immediately transfer them to the bowl of ice water to prevent the shrimp from continuing to cook. Set aside.
-
In a large bowl, mix together the clamato, ketchup, orange soda, and lime juice until combined. Stir in the tomatoes, cucumber, jalapeño, onion, and cilantro. Taste and add salt as needed.
-
Transfer the shrimp to the bowl of sauce. Cover and refrigerate for 2 hours to chill the cóctel de camaron and to meld the flavors together.
-
Stir in the diced avocados and serve immediately with tostadas or saltine crackers.
